We offer three different levels of medical transport:

BASIC LIFE SUPPORT

Basic Life Support (BLS) ambulance services are designed for nonemergency inter-facility transportation between hospitals, assisted living facilities or nursing homes and private homes, and pre-hospital response for ill or injured patients.

Each unit is staffed with two compassionate, licensed professionals. Our basic life support ambulances are outfitted by Demers Ambulances and American Emergency Vehicles (AEV), the leaders in medical technology.

ADVANCED LIFE SUPPORT

The Advanced Life Support (ALS) ambulance units have a minimum of one paramedic and one emergency medical technician. They are able to administer certain medications, and the ambulances have advanced equipment for ill or injured patients.

Priority Ambulance’s critical care ambulances are outfitted by Taylor Made Ambulances. Each ambulance is stocked with the latest in lifesaving equipment to ensure that you or your loved one receive the best available medical transport care.

CRITICAL CARE TRANSPORT

Priority Ambulance’s critical care ambulances are equipped with the latest lifesaving emergency technology to handle any situation that may arise when transporting critically ill patients. The paramedics who staff these vehicles have at least three years of experience handling critical care patients and are specially trained to administer the required level of care. AMBULANCE SUBSCRIPTION PROGRAM

To financially safeguard your family against unforeseen medical emergencies, Priority Ambulance offers any Annual Subscription Plan to cover out-of-pocket costs of any medically necessary transport by Priority Ambulance. Our subscription program is not health insurance and does not replace primary insurance. Health insurance, however, does not pay 100 percent of your bill. After the subscriber’s primary insurance is billed, a Priority Ambulance annual subscription will cover additional balances, deductibles or co-pays for services deemed medically necessary by a physician.
